file-type

STM32多路数据采集系统源码与项目资源下载

版权申诉
226KB | 更新于2024-10-29 | 197 浏览量 | 0 下载量 举报 收藏
download 限时特惠:#69.90
该系统具备抗工频干扰的能力,能够处理多路高精度数据的采集任务。资源包中涵盖了众多技术领域的项目资源,如前端、后端、移动开发、操作系统、人工智能、物联网、信息化管理、数据库、硬件开发、大数据、课程资源、音视频、网站开发等。具体涉及的技术栈包括STM32、ESP8266、PHP、QT、Linux、iOS、C++、Java、Python、Web、C#、EDA、Proteus、RTOS等。所有源码均经过严格测试,确保功能正常无误后上传,适合于不同技术水平的学习者,无论是初学者还是有基础的进阶学习者,都可以利用这些资源进行学习、实践和研究。资源包还鼓励用户之间的交流沟通,提供博主联系方式以解答使用过程中的问题,促进学习者的共同进步。" 知识点详细说明: 1. STM32微控制器开发:STM32是STMicroelectronics生产的32位ARM Cortex-M微控制器系列,广泛应用于嵌入式系统和物联网领域。该资源包中的项目就是基于STM32实现的,涉及到STM32的编程、外围电路的设计、固件的开发等。 2. 数据采集系统:数据采集系统主要是指能够采集环境或设备信息的电子设备。在这里,系统需要具备高精度和抗工频干扰的能力,保证采集到的数据准确无误。对于多路数据的采集,可能涉及到多通道数据的同步采样、信号放大、滤波、模数转换(ADC)等技术。 3. 工频干扰处理:工频干扰指的是50Hz或60Hz的工业频率干扰,这是在工业环境中常见的电磁干扰。在数据采集系统中,必须采取措施来降低或消除这种干扰,以保证数据的准确性。这通常涉及硬件滤波器设计、软件滤波算法等。 4. 硬件开发:硬件开发包括电路设计、PCB布局、电路板制作等过程,是实现电子产品的基础。资源包中应该包含了用于STM32的硬件原理图,以及可能的PCB设计文件。 5. 编程语言与开发工具:资源包中涉及到的编程语言和技术栈非常广泛,包括但不限于C++、Java、Python、C#等。开发者需要熟悉这些编程语言以及相应的开发环境和工具链。 6. 前端、后端、移动开发、操作系统、人工智能、物联网、信息化管理、数据库等技术:这些技术是现代信息技术的关键组成部分,资源包中的源码覆盖了这些领域,可以提供学习和实践的实例。 7. 项目资源的应用场景:资源包中的项目源码可以应用于多个学习和实践的场景,包括毕业设计、课程设计、大作业、工程实训等,也可以作为初期项目立项的参考资料。 8. 开源与复用性:资源包中的代码和文档遵循开源协议,允许用户下载、使用、修改和重新分发,为学习者提供了极大的灵活性和扩展性。 9. 社区交流:资源包鼓励用户之间进行交流和沟通,这对于学习者来说非常重要。通过社区的力量,可以更快地解决问题,分享经验,从而加速学习进程。 10. 教育价值:资源包对于技术教育具有很大的价值,它可以作为学生和技术爱好者的教程和实践案例,帮助他们了解实际项目开发的流程和经验。

相关推荐

CyMylive.
  • 粉丝: 1w+
上传资源 快速赚钱